J. Jouzel is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Ecology and Global and Planetary Change. According to data from OpenAlex, J. Jouzel has authored 164 papers receiving a total of 14.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 149 papers in Atmospheric Science, 52 papers in Ecology and 31 papers in Global and Planetary Change. Recurrent topics in J. Jouzel’s work include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(124 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(100 papers) and Isotope Analysis in Ecology (36 papers). J. Jouzel is often cited by papers focused on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(124 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(100 papers) and Isotope Analysis in Ecology (36 papers). J. Jouzel coll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and United Kingdom. J. Jouzel's co-authors include S. J. Johnsen, C. Lorius, James W. C. White, Valérie Masson‐Delmotte, M. Stiévenard, M. Stuiver, Pieter Meiert Grootes, Roland Souchez, Dominique Raynaud and J. R. Petit and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
